Carbon Tax in Ireland – How Much Is It ?
A carbon tax is a tax on the use of fossil fuels such as oil, petrol, diesel, gas, coal and peat. Budget 2022 announced an increase to the Carbon Tax in Ireland. The Carbon Tax rate of €33.50 a tonne was increased by €7.50 a tonne to around €41 a tonne. That resulted in a […]

Oil Prices Rising – Middle East Unrest
Oil prices have climbed to their highest level in 30 months in London as Libya’s uprising reduced shipments and sparked fears of unrest spreading across the Middle East. Brent crude hit $119 a barrel for the first time since August 2008. Major western oil companies, such as Italian firm Eni and Spain’s Repsol-YPF, have suspended […]

New Carbon Tax in Budget 2010
A new carbon tax of €15 Euro per Tonne was announced in the 2010 Budget. The tax will apply to Petrol and Diesel from midnight tonight. Petrol will go up by 4.2c a litre and deisel by 4.9c a litre The Carbon tax will apply from 1 May 2010 to Kerosene, Marked Gas Oil, Liquid […]
